Setting up a scene

By running the app built so far, you might have noticed that, when you select the Play button, the app crashes. This is because GameViewController expects to be set up by the Storyboard where the view is actually SCNView; because the view is a plain UIView, it crashes.

To fix this issue, we need to build a slim GameViewController from scratch:

import UIKit import QuartzCore import SceneKit class GameViewController: UIViewController { private let scnView = SCNView() private var scene: SCNScene! override func viewDidLoad() { super.viewDidLoad() scnView.frame = view.bounds view.addSubview(scnView) createContents() } override func prefersStatusBarHidden() ...
